3. Take more time for self care
Whether it’s leaving the office to stretch our legs during lunch, or making sure we get to yoga, self care needs to be a priority for all of us. We all know the ill effects of stress and inactivity, but we don’t often reflect on the positive benefits from taking even a 15-minute break. Some of our best problem solving and creative breakthroughs have been when we offer our mind a chance to explore something different than the task at hand. Don’t think of taking a walk in the park, visiting a museum, or taking the time to meditate as a guilty pleasure. Instead, remember that recharging will make you a better designer.
